Regarding your comment on the getter/setter syntax. To be honest, the problem that I see in your example code is not so much the fact that the programmer has to be aware that they are calling a method. I think the problem lies within the fact that there is something other than a method that can be adressed with object.something. I've seen, written and reviewed my fair share of Java code in particular and so far, nobody could ever provide me with a reasonable example why public member variables (with the sole exception of public static final constants) are necessary. They break encapsulation. Once exposed in public API, a field can never be replaced with a getter, whereas a method body can be modified freely as long as the contract isn't violated. Public members always means exposing more internal logic than necessary. To be honest, I consider public non-constant fields deprecated and even harmful. If you only ever expose methods, then object.something can only have one meaning: it's a getter (or setter). No arcane magic here to keep in mind. Perhaps somebody can prove me wrong here, but I've yet to see a real use case for public non-constant fields, other than "I'm too lazy to write a getter/setter pair for that."
